Overview Business schools in Newcastle

Newcastle is a vibrant city in the north-east of England that is home to several prestigious business schools. One of the most prominent of these is Newcastle University Business School, which is consistently ranked among the top 20 business schools in the UK. The school offers a range of undergraduate, postgraduate, and executive education programs in business, management, and entrepreneurship, with a particular focus on sustainability and responsible business practices. It boasts state-of-the-art facilities, a world-class teaching faculty, and a strong network of industry partnerships, making it an excellent choice for students looking to kick-start their careers in business.

Another notable business school in Newcastle is Northumbria University Business School, which is renowned for its cutting-edge research and innovative teaching methods. The school offers a range of undergraduate, postgraduate, and professional development programs in areas such as accounting, marketing, and human resource management, and has a strong focus on entrepreneurship and innovation. It has strong links with industry and provides students with plenty of opportunities to gain practical experience through internships, placements, and live projects. Overall, Newcastle is a great destination for those looking to study business, with its thriving business community, excellent academic institutions, and vibrant cultural scene.

Who are the leading Business schools in Newcastle

Newcastle is home to several leading business schools that offer world-class education and training to students looking to excel in the field of business. One such institution is Newcastle University Business School. It offers a wide range of undergraduate, postgraduate, and executive education programs in various areas of business, including accounting, finance, marketing, and entrepreneurship. The school is known for its innovative teaching methods, cutting-edge research, and strong links with industry, which help students develop the skills and knowledge required to succeed in today’s global business environment.

Another top business school in Newcastle is Northumbria University Business School. It is one of the largest business schools in the UK and has a reputation for delivering practical and relevant education that prepares graduates for the real world. Northumbria University Business School offers a diverse range of programs, including undergraduate, postgraduate, and executive education courses in areas such as business management, economics, human resource management, and international business. The school is also known for its strong industry partnerships and its focus on employability, which ensures that graduates are well-equipped to succeed in their chosen careers.

Cost of Business Schools in Newcastle

There are several costs involved in instructing business schools in Newcastle, which can be broadly categorized into three main groups: tuition fees, living expenses, and miscellaneous expenses. Let’s take a closer look at each of these categories.

1. Tuition Fees: This is the primary cost associated with pursuing a business education in Newcastle. The tuition fees vary depending on the type of program and the institution you choose. For instance, the tuition fees for an undergraduate business program at Newcastle University can range from £17,935 to £23,935 per year. Similarly, if you opt for a postgraduate program, the tuition fee can go up to £25,935 per year. It is essential to note that these fees are subject to change, and you should check with the institution before applying.

2. Living Expenses: Living expenses are another significant cost associated with studying in Newcastle. The cost of accommodation, food, and transportation can add up over time. The cost of living in Newcastle is relatively affordable compared to other UK cities, but it still depends on your lifestyle. On average, you can expect to pay around £600 to £800 per month for accommodation. Food and drink expenses can range from £200 to £300 per month, while transportation can cost approximately £50 to £80 per month.

3. Miscellaneous Expenses: There are several other costs that you need to consider when studying in Newcastle. These include textbooks, course materials, stationery, and other supplies. The cost of textbooks, in particular, can be quite high, depending on the course you are taking. You should also factor in the cost of healthcare insurance, which is mandatory in the UK for international students. The cost of this insurance can range from £150 to £300 per year, depending on the provider.

In summary, the cost of instructing business schools in Newcastle depends on various factors, including the institution, program, and lifestyle. You should budget for tuition fees, accommodation, food, transportation, and other miscellaneous expenses to ensure you have enough money to comfortably pursue your studies. It is essential to research and plan to avoid any financial surprises and make the most out of your education.
